The Role of Residential Door Specialists
Residential door specialists are professionals trained to help house owners in selecting, installing, and preserving various types of doors. Their proficiency encompasses comprehending the qualities of various products (such as wood, steel, fiberglass, and glass), door designs, security features, and energy performance considerations.

Residential door specialists use different kinds of doors, each serving distinct functions and contributing in a different way to a home's visual and security. Below are some common kinds of residential doors:
Door TypeDescriptionTypical MaterialsFunctionsEntry DoorsFront doors that develop the very first impression of a home.Wood, fiberglass, steelDecorative components, insulationInterior DoorsDoors utilized within the home to different spaces.Hollow core, strong woodSoundproofing, sliding optionsPatio DoorsDoors that open to outside spaces, enabling natural light and gain access to.Sliding glass, French doorsEnergy performance, security locksStorm DoorsProtective doors placed in front of entry doors to protect from components.Aluminum, glassSupport, energy performanceGarage DoorsDoors that supply access to garages, typically automated.Steel, woodInsulation, automated openersPicking the Right Residential Door Specialist

Q: What are common materials used for residential doors?A: Common products include wood, fiberglass, and steel, each offering unique advantages in regards to visual appeals, security, and energy performance.
Q: How do I preserve my residential doors?A: Regular upkeep includes lubing hinges, cleaning up surface areas, checking seals, and guaranteeing positioning for correct function.
Q: When should I think about changing my doors?A: Consider replacement if doors show signs of warping, harmed surfaces, bad insulation, or out-of-date styles that no longer fulfill your requirements.
